Mời các bạn cùng tham khảo Bài giảng Mã nguồn mở - Bài 6: Lập trình Shell trong Linux để nắm tổng quan về lập trình shell trong Linux; một số lệnh lập trình Shell; lập trình C trên Linux.
Kernel quy ế t đị nh ai s ẽ s ử d ụ ng tài nguyên này, trong kho ả ng bao lâu và khi nào. Nó ch ạ y các ch ươ ng trình c ủ a b ạ n (ho ặ c th ự c thi các t ậ p tin nh ị phân). Kernel làm trung gian gi ữ a ph ầ n c ứ ng và các ch ươ ng trình/ ứ ng d ụ ng/shell. Các công vi ệ c mà nó[r]
Shell: Máy tính hiểu ngôn ngữ 0 và 1 gọi là ngôn ngữ nhị phân. Thời kỳ đầu của máy tính, các chỉ dẫn sử dụng ngôn ngữ nhị phân - rất khó hiểu. Vì thế Os có một chương trình đặc biệt được gọi là Shell. Shell chấp nhận các chỉ dẫn hoặc các lệnh bằng tiếng Anh (hầu hết) và nếu[r]
Danh sách các câu lệnh cơ bản trong Ubuntu Chương 1 : Phần mềm mã nguồn mở (20 câu) Chương 2 : Hệ điều hành LINUX (95 câu) Chương 3 & 4 : Lập trình C & SHELL (34 Câu)
CẤU TRÚC LẬP TRÌNH TRONG SHELL TIẾP THEO • Lệnh lặp for: Trong Linux lệnh for có thể thực hiện theo một số dạng sau Cú pháp: for {tên biến} in {danh sách giá trị} do Khối lệnh done for[r]
Giải bài tập shell linux cơ bản chi tiết. Làm quen hệ điều hành linux. Lập trình nhúng. Hệ điều hành nhúng.Giải bài tập shell linux cơ bản chi tiết. Làm quen hệ điều hành linux. Lập trình nhúng. Hệ điều hành nhúng.
Nhiều lệnh trên một dòng Thông thường shell thông dịch từ đầu tiên như là lệnh còn các phần sau trở thành các đối số của lệnh. Có 3 ký tự đặc biệt mà khi shell thông dịch mà gặp phải sẽ hiểu sau đó là có một lệnh tiếp theo cần thực hiện đó là (;), (&), (|).
Subshell là m ộ t b ắ t ch ướ c (clone) c ủ a Shell hi ệ n t ạ i , nh ư ng b ở i vì các ti ế n trình con không th ể thay đổ i môi tr ườ ng c ủ a ti ế n trình cha , m ọ i l ệ nh ch ạ y trong m ộ t subshell không ảnh hưởng đến môi trường khi nhóm lệnh kết thúc .[r]
Các biến trong Shell: Để xử lý dữ liệu/thông tin, dữ liệu phải được giữ trong bộ nhớ RAM của máy tính. RAM được chia thành nhiều vị trí nhỏ, và mỗi vị trí có một số duy nhất được gọi là địa chỉ bộ nhớ - được sử dụng để lưu dữ liệu. Bạn có thể gán tên cho vùng nhớ này => gọi là biến bộ n[r]
Chương 2 - Lập trình vào ra căn bản trên Linux. Những nội dung chính trong chương này gồm có: Cài đặt môi trường phát triển, cơ bản về lập trình Linux, cơ chế lập trình giao tiếp thiết bị, lập trình điều khiển led, lập trình ghép nối nút bấm.
- C shell, sử dụng cú pháp của ngôn ngữ lập trình C và có thêm nhiều chức năng tiện lợi. Thông th−ờng các hệ thống có ít nhất là một loại shell và thông th−ờng Bourne shell đ−ợc sử dụng để viết shell script, còn sử dụng một loại khác cho việc t−ơng tác. Tệp[r]
glibc, th ư vi ệ n này cung c ấ p cho ng ườ i dùng r ấ t nhi ề u l ờ i g ọ i h ệ th ố ng. Các th ư vi ệ n trên Linux th ườ ng đượ c t ổ ch ứ c d ướ i d ạ ng t ĩ nh (static library), th ư vi ệ n chia s ẻ (shared library) và độ ng (dynamic library - gi ố ng nh ư DLL trên MS[r]
Bài giảng Phát triển phần mềm mã nguồn mở: Linux operating system cung cấp cho người học các kiến thức: Tổng quan về hệ điều hành Linux, hệ thống tập tin trên Linux, bộ thông dịch lệnh, lập trình shell script. Mời các bạn cùng tham khảo.
$0, $1, $2,..., $9 Tham biến “$0” chứa tên của lệnh, các tham biến thực bắt đầu bằng “$1” (nếu tham số có vị trí lớn hơn 9, ta phải sử dụng cú pháp ${} – ví dụ, ${10} để thu đƣợc các giá trị của chúng). Shell bash có ba tham biến vị trí đặc biệt, “$#”, “$@”, và “$[r]
1. Tổng quan • Shell là chương trình luôn được thực thi khi người dùng đăng nhập vào hệ thống. • Shell Linux hỗ trợ một tập lệnh mà có thể kết hợp chúng lại thành một script hay thành một chương trình có thể sử dụng nhiều lần.
Chương 5 giới thiệu về Linux Shell thông qua các nội dung sau: Giới thiệu về Shells, môi trường làm việc với Shell, lập trình Shell (Bash), Debugging Shell scripts, Built-in Shell commands, các tiện ích (tools) trong Shell.
Bài giảng Phát triển phần mềm mã nguồn mở: Linux operating system cung cấp cho người học các kiến thức: Tổng quan về hệ điều hành Linux, hệ thống tập tin trên Linux, bộ thông dịch lệnh, lập trình shell script. Mời các bạn cùng tham khảo.
Mời các bạn tham khảo Bài giảng Hệ điều hành Linux - Bài 9: Lập trình SHELL sau đây để nắm bắt được những kiến thức về SHELL, trình thông dịch SHELL, cấu hình phiên làm việc, lập trình SHELL.
Vi Reference Card Modes Vi has two modes: insertion mode, and command mode. The editor begins in command mode, where cursor move- ment and text deletion and pasting occur. Insertion mode begins upon entering an insertion or change command. [ESC] returns the editor to command mode (where you can[r]